'Fix costumes or film will be banned in Madhya Pradesh': Minister Narottam Mishra on Pathaan song

| @indiablooms | Dec 15, 2022, at 06:08 am

Bhopal/IBNS: Madhya Pradesh Minister Narottam Mishra on Wednesday is unhappy over the use of saffron costumes in the first released song 'Besharam Rang' from the Shah Rukh Khan-Deepika Padukone starrer film 'Pathaan'.

He also said that the film contains some objectionable scenes, and threatened to ban Pathaan in Madhya Pradesh if those shots are not replaced.

He said that the costumes and scenes should be fixed or deleted if the film has to be considered for release in MP.

He said the "green" and "saffron" colours of the attire of the cast need to be "rectified" along with the lyrics of the song as well as the title of the film, which will hit the screens next month.

He also targeted Khan, saying while the actor visits the Vaishno Devi shrine but he acts in films where women actors wear bikinis.

Mishra's statement came after the song 'Besharam Rang' was released recently.

In the 3:14-minute song, which was launched on Monday, Deepika is mostly seen wearing monokinis and bikinis as she offers love to Shah Rukh on-screen.

Shah Rukh and Deepika collaborated for the fourth time as an on-screen pair with Pathaan. The earlier three films were Om Shanti Om, Chennai Express and Dilwale.

The visually spectacular Yash Raj Films' action extravaganza, Pathaan, is part of Aditya Chopra’s ambitious spy universe and also stars John Abraham in the lead.

Pathaan is slated for Jan 25, 2023 release.
